Transaction e8f6945cefae0481792653850324953e385ce7778e6fa99813c4abe3e4bbeab5
1 Input
1 Output
-
e8f6945cefae0481792653850324953e385ce7778e6fa99813c4abe3e4bbeab5:0
- value
- 67715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68fbdf01d631db212dc1d38a47a6b2680e3c54ae OP_EQUAL
- address
- 3BG7vojBb13brke5x8fcDJSC3e8scAM3YR